According to the US Dept of Justice, table 9, 53% of prisoners in state prisons were there for violent offenses, 16.8% for drug offenses. There is may be more turnover with the drug offenses.
http://www.bjs.gov/content/pub/pdf/p12ac.pdf
There are about 12% as many federal as state prisoners sentenced.
And there are about a third as many people in jail as in federal or state prison. The violent offense rate is lower there, the drug offense higher than state prison.
